The cheapest way to get from Moalboal to Maasin is to taxi and ferry via Talisay which costs ₱1,500 - ₱7,500 and takes 8h 35m.
The fastest way to get from Moalboal to Maasin is to taxi and ferry which takes 4h 27m and costs ₱2,600 - ₱4,100.
The distance between Moalboal and Maasin is 405 km.
The best way to get from Moalboal to Maasin without a car is to taxi and ferry which takes 4h 27m and costs ₱2,600 - ₱4,100.
It takes approximately 4h 27m to get from Moalboal to Maasin, including transfers.
There are 19+ hotels available in Maasin.
What companies run services between Moalboal, Philippines and Maasin, Philippines?
There is no direct connection from Moalboal to Maasin. However, you can take the taxi to Cebu Pier then take the ferry to Maasin. Alternatively, you can take the taxi to Naga, take the ferry to Cebu Pier 1, walk to Cebu Pier, then take the ferry to Maasin.
